Ecchi Sky was one of the shovelware adult oriented puzzle games released by a developer STREAMWORKS.

The game was released on May 30, 2019 on Steam.

The game is no longer available for sale, most likely due to developer stealing art[1] and advertising the game with features that either didn't work or were flat out missing.[2]
